1.
This Official Liquidator's Report prays for the following directions:- "a) In view of the submission made in para (11), (12) & (15) supra of this report, whether this Hon'ble Court may be pleased to allow the Official Liquidator to file Writ Petition challenging the order dated 15/04/2024 passed by the Hon'ble District Judge-2, Pune in Civil Misc. Application No. 477 of 2022 thereby rejecting the Application below (Exhibit-42) for framing preliminary issue of limitation without providing detailed reasoning."

2.
When the matter is called out, learned Counsel appearing for the Noticees No. 3 and 4 points out that the preliminary objection raised on the issue of limitation has been rejected by the District Judge at Pune on the ground that the preliminary issue involves mixed questions of law and facts and therefore, the learned Judge has kept the point of limitation open to be decided along with other issues while deciding the main application under Section 34 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act. That, therefore, this Court not entertain the prayer made by the Official Liquidator.
3.
Mr. Sheth, learned Counsel appears for the Official Liquidator and submits that since there was a delay of more than 1000 days and considering the fact that in a commercial arbitration, the application under Section 34 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act cannot be filed beyond the period of 120 days, the said application before the District Judge is barred by limitation and that the preliminary issue raised by the Official Liquidator ought to have been considered and the Application under Section 34 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act ought to have been dismissed on that ground.
4.
Mr. Satija, learned Counsel appearing for the Sicom Limited and Mr. Kadam, learned Counsel appearing for the MSFC submit that since 2/4
the signed certified copy of the award was received on 24th February, 2022, there is no delay in filing the Applications under Section 34 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, which is disputed by the learned Counsel for the Official Liquidator as well as Ex-Director present in the Court, who is Noticee No.1 to the Official Liquidator's Report 5.
I have perused the order passed by the learned District Judge. From a perusal of paragraphs 5 and 6 of the order and the contentions raised with respect to the number of days of delay, the learned Counsel for the Official Liquidator submitting that the delay is more than 1000 days and the learned Counsel for the Sicom and MSFC submitting that there is no delay as the signed certified copy of the award was received on 24th February, 2022, it emerges that there is a mixed question of fact and law and therefore, the point of limitation has correctly been kept open to be decided along with other issues while deciding the Application under Section 34 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, to be considered along with other issues. I, therefore, do not consider it necessary for the Official Liquidator to file any Petition challenging the order dated 15th April, 2024 of the learned District Judge in Civil Misc. Application No. 477 of 2022.
